“Bua Chu” Project is carried out to bring a new perspective on the talisman. In addition, this project also creates a satirical meaning to highlight recent social issues, thereby raising people’s awareness to take a positive look at the issues.
With a brand-new design inspired from the combination of fresh modern colors and drawings combined with the mysterious traditional talisman, the project creates a wide range of artistic products that are not only joyful but also satirical, conveying a meaningful message to raise society-related problems through mantras, illustrations on the talisman with the hope of creating a better lifestyle in the modern world.
The "Bua Chu" project utilizes the core elements of a traditional charm, which is haunting and somewhat confusing, to give birth to a new kind of charm with more captivating stories. With contrasting color combination and intentionally folded paper textures, the "Charm" shows the ancient mixed with the modernity of the design with illustrations, colors and typography. Hopefully, with "Charm", viewers will have an interesting, fun and deeper understanding in order to discover many intriguing stories behind.
